The system triggers “Just in Time (JIT)” if one of the following actions occurs:

  • OSP knows the proposal has of a fundable score and creates a child Pre-Award Notification (PAN), selecting the Just-in-Time check box
  • OSP receives funding for an approved eGC1 and creates a child Funding Action (FA)
  • OSP manually changes the status of an approved eGC1 to Awarded

Note: If the Royalty Research Fund (RRF) is the sponsor, then the creation of a child Funding Action will NOT trigger JIT.

Once JIT occurs, a batch job that runs twice a day (mid-day and late evening) sends email notifications to the following people associated with the eGC1:

  • The PI, Application PI, Administrative Contact, Pre-Award Budget Contact, and the eGC1 Preparer are notified that JIT occurred. They should ensure that the personnel list is up-to-date.
  • Any investigators who have not yet created a disclosure for this eGC1 are notified to do so. The system will create pending disclosures.
  • Any investigators who have not yet taken the required FCOI training receive a reminder of the requirement.

May 2015 Maintenance Release

Revised Disclosure Review Statuses

A new Review Status of “Pending Answer” has been added so that the SFI disclosure reviewers in the Office of Research can identify those disclosures whose review is pending additional information from the investigator. The Review Status of “Duplicate” was removed, and all disclosures in that status were moved to “No Review Required” status.

Disclosure Notification Changes

In order to ensure attention is drawn to situations where an investigator may not be receiving a disclosure notification email, there are some changes being introduced to the eGC1s in SAGE.

  • Providing visibility when an investigator’s email address is missing which means no disclosure notification can be sent. When no email address is available, the eGC1 Preparer will be sent an email they can forward to the investigator.
  • Requiring the eGC1 Preparer’s email address, used for key notifications.

October 2014

An issue in FIDS that caused disclosure notifications to be sent to investigators who had already completed a primary eGC1 disclosure has been fixed. Investigators will only receive notifications if they have not already been sent one and if they have not already completed a primary disclosure for that eGC1.

Pending Disclosures

A pending disclosure is a one you need to complete. The system creates one when either an eGC1 owner or the system sends disclosure notification emails to the investigators. The eGC1 owner can do this by clicking the Send Disclosure Notification button on the PI, Personnel, & Organizations page. If the owner routes the eGC1 to reviewers for approval without sending the notifications, the system will send them automatically.

The system also creates a pending disclosure when an investigator begins, but does not complete, a disclosure for Human Subjects Activity or a CoMotion Technology Transfer Agreement.

The Action Items section of the page lists any pending disclosures. To complete a pending disclosure for a specific eGC1, CoMotion agreement, or Human Subjects Activity, click on the Complete Disclosure button to the right of the disclosure.  Then make any necessary updates to your Significant Financial Interests (SFI) and enter any other required information. For an eGC1 disclosure, its status will display on the eGC1’s PI, Personnel, & Organizations page.

November 2012

  • In the Related Activities section, there is no longer a Select All link, and there is a new checkbox for investigators that causes the Related Activities section to display.
  • New functionality for creating new disclosures
    • A “Create new disclosure” button displays whenever there is not a pending disclosure.
    • Investigators will now select why they are creating the disclosure.
    • Investigators can create their own pending disclosure for an eGC1, without having to wait for the disclosure notification to be sent from the eGC1.
    • Investigators can create disclosures for the Human Subjects Division (HSD) and the Center for Commercialization (C4C).
    • An email message will be sent to C4C when a disclosure has been created asking C4C to forward the license agreement.
    • The disclosure now shows HSD and C4C details.
  • When investigators are removed from an eGC1, any pending disclosures will be deleted. If they completed a disclosure, then the primary eGC1 will be removed.
  • A pending disclosure is automatically created when investigators add themselves to an eGC1.
